House & Garden Shooting Powder est un engrais de floraison en poudre sèche, conçu pour optimiser le rendement floral en favorisant la production d'énergie et d'huiles essentielles. Il agit en fin de floraison.

Shooting Powder fournit des précurseurs nutritifs essentiels à la synthèse d'ATP, soutenant ainsi les processus biologiques indispensables aux plantes lors de la maturation des fleurs. Sa formule est décrite comme apportant des nutriments rapidement assimilables et solubles, contribuant à maintenir une forte croissance en fin de floraison. Cette disponibilité accrue des nutriments, ciblée sur la phase finale de floraison, favorise une croissance plus rapide, une vigueur renforcée et des rendements plus élevés lorsque les plantes en ont le plus besoin.

Ce stimulateur de floraison tardive est conçu pour initier une seconde phase de floraison, prolongeant ainsi la production naturelle de fleurs en fin de cycle. Il vise également à augmenter la taille et le poids des fleurs, pour une récolte plus abondante sans altérer les caractéristiques générales de la culture. Outre son action sur le rendement et la densité, Shooting Powder fournit les nutriments essentiels à la synthèse des phospholipides, indispensable à la synthèse des huiles – un élément clé de la qualité finale, lié à la façon dont les plantes synthétisent et stockent les composés essentiels pendant la floraison.

Shooting Powder est idéal pour la floraison tardive et est conçu pour être performant dans tous les milieux de culture, y compris les systèmes hydroponiques et en terre. Il est également décrit comme ne contenant ni régulateurs de croissance synthétiques ni métaux lourds détectables, un critère de qualité essentiel pour de nombreux cultivateurs recherchant un engrais de finition. Ses principaux composants sont l'acide phosphorique et l'oxyde de potassium, ce qui explique son rôle de PK soluble pour la floraison, favorisant le rendement floral et une floraison optimale.

Week-by-week feeding schedule

Vegetative stage — Shooting Powder

  • Week 1: do not use this product during this week of vegetative growth.
  • Week 2: do not use this product during this week of vegetative growth.
  • Week 3: do not use this product during this week of vegetative growth.

Flowering stage — Shooting Powder

  • Week 1: do not use this product during this week of flowering.
  • Week 2: do not use this product during this week of flowering.
  • Week 3: do not use this product during this week of flowering.
  • Week 4: do not use this product during this week of flowering.
  • Week 5: do not use this product during this week of flowering.
  • Week 6: mix 0.65 g per litre of water or nutrient solution.
  • Week 7: mix 1.3 g per litre of water or nutrient solution.
  • Week 8: mix 1.3 g per litre of water or nutrient solution.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does available phosphate (P₂O₅) do for plant growth?

Available Phosphate (P₂O₅) supports root development, energy transfer, and early structural growth by providing a form of phosphorus that plants can absorb and use quickly.

Why is soluble potash (K2O) important for plants?

Soluble potash (K2O) is important because it helps plants control water use, move sugars to new growth and fruit, and build stronger, higher-quality structure under stress. It’s unique from many other nutrients because it acts more like a regulator and transport helper than a direct “building material,” so the biggest benefits show up as steadier growth, stronger stems, and better finishing instead of just bigger leaves.

Can phosphoric acid cause nutrient lockout?

Yes, it can if it pushes phosphorus too high or drives pH too low, because both conditions can reduce the plant’s ability to take up key micronutrients and calcium even when they’re present in the feed, which makes phosphoric acid uniquely powerful compared with slower, gentler phosphorus sources.

Why is potassium oxide (K2O) important for plant growth, and what makes it different from other nutrients?

Potassium oxide (K2O) is important because it shows how much potassium is available to support water control, sugar movement, and strong plant structure, which directly impacts growth quality and stress tolerance. It’s unique because K2O is mainly a label standard for potassium content, not a separate nutrient form the plant absorbs, so understanding it helps you avoid mixing up label numbers with real potassium needs.
